On Thursday I took a quick detour into DC that led me to Cane on H Street. Cane is a family-owned business run by Chef Peter Prime and Jeanine Prime (a brother and sister duo). It’s based on popular street foods in Trinidad & Tobago. I almost ordered the entire menu! After I calmed down, I ordered the Trini-Asian 5-spice drums, Doubles (Indian fried bread, cumin-spiced Channa (chickpea)), Eggplant Choka and Rice (I tasted coconut!). Everything was soooo delicious and seasoned really well. Of course the restaurant would have plated a lot better than me but I did my best! There was even enough food for leftovers the next day.
